Principles for conducting adversarial robustness evaluations across common threat models and realistic deployment scenarios.
This evergreen guide details robust evaluation practices balancing threat models, deployment realities, and measurable safeguards to ensure trustworthy, resilient machine learning systems.
July 28, 2025
Facebook X Reddit
Adversarial robustness evaluation sits at the intersection of theory and practice, demanding a disciplined framework that translates academic concepts into actionable testing. The most effective evaluations start by articulating clear threat models that reflect real-world constraints, such as limited access, noisy data, or resource restrictions. Researchers define objective metrics, establish baselines, and identify failure modes early in the process. Practical evaluations incorporate reproducible data splits, documented experimental pipelines, and transparent reporting of uncertainty. They also consider the end user’s perspective, recognizing that robustness is not merely a property of an isolated model but a characteristic of entire systems operating under varying conditions. This approach helps separate engineering risk from theoretical vulnerability.
A rigorous evaluation strategy requires alignment between threat models, deployment context, and measurable outcomes. Begin by mapping adversary capabilities to concrete scenarios: data poisoning in supply chains, evasion through crafted inputs, or model theft via inference attacks. Next, establish success criteria that reflect safety, reliability, and user trust. This includes metrics such as detection rate, false positives, latency overhead, and the stability of predictions under perturbations. When possible, incorporate red teaming to simulate attacker behavior and uncover hidden weaknesses. Document all assumptions and acknowledge uncertainty in each result. A disciplined methodology reduces ambiguity, supports comparability across studies, and helps stakeholders weigh the cost of defenses against potential harm.
Focus on end-to-end resilience with transparent, repeatable testing.
Real-world deployments differ from laboratory settings in predictable ways, and this gap must be explicitly addressed. Data distribution shifts, evolving user behavior, and hardware variability all influence robustness. Evaluations should include scenario-based testing that mirrors anticipated conditions, such as skewed class distributions or streaming data with concept drift. Researchers can use synthetic perturbations alongside real-world samples to stress-test models under plausible stressors. It is essential to quantify how performance degrades as inputs move away from the training distribution. By presenting a spectrum of outcomes, evaluators convey both strengths and limitations, guiding practitioners toward meaningful improvements rather than hollow triumphs.
ADVERTISEMENT
ADVERTISEMENT
Beyond accuracy, robustness evaluations should examine system cohesion and downstream effects. Models rarely operate in isolation; their outputs influence decision pipelines, human operators, and automated controls. Therefore, tests must capture cascading failures, latency impacts, and feedback loops that could amplify minor weaknesses. Incorporating end-to-end testing helps reveal how a seemingly small perturbation can propagate through the pipeline. Transparency about trade-offs—privacy, computation, and user experience—is crucial. When teams communicate results, they should prioritize clarity over jargon, enabling operators, policymakers, and customers to understand what robustness means in practical terms and how it can be improved.
Build threats into the evaluation plan with repeatable experiments.
A principled robustness program begins with data governance that emphasizes integrity, provenance, and anomaly detection. Ensuring data quality reduces the chance that spurious correlations masquerade as genuine robustness. Evaluation should include audits of labeling policies, dataset versioning, and exposure to diverse populations. When possible, use benchmark suites that reflect real user diversity rather than narrow, curated samples. Document the dataset construction process, including any substitutions or exclusions that could bias results. By establishing rigorous data standards, teams create a stable platform for assessing model behavior under adversarial influence and avoid conflating data issues with model faults.
ADVERTISEMENT
ADVERTISEMENT
Threat modeling at the data and model layers facilitates targeted defenses. Begin by itemizing potential attack surfaces, including training pipelines, inference interfaces, and model access controls. For each surface, outline plausible attack vectors, their likelihood, and potential impact. This structured analysis informs where to invest in defenses such as input validation, anomaly detection, or secure hardware. Importantly, evaluators should verify defense efficacy under realistic conditions, not just idealized tests. Reproducible evaluations—shared code, fixed seeds, and versioned environments—enable independent verification and strengthen confidence in claimed improvements. A disciplined threat model becomes a living document that evolves with new insights and threats.
Share hands-on findings and actionable improvements for practitioners.
When designing adversarial tests, balance extremity with relevance. Extremely contrived attacks may reveal theoretical vulnerabilities but offer little practical guidance. Conversely, testing only on standard benchmarks can overlook real-world cunning. A balanced test suite includes both crafted perturbations and naturally occurring anomalies observed in deployment data. Evaluators should also examine robustness across diverse operating conditions, including shifts in latency, bandwidth, and concurrent workloads. Choosing representative perturbations, varying their intensity, and tracking performance across scenarios yields a more nuanced understanding of resilience. The goal is to learn which defenses generalize beyond narrow conditions and which require bespoke tailoring for specific contexts.
Reporting results with humility and specificity strengthens trust. Present results with confidence intervals to convey uncertainty, and avoid overstating significance. Clearly describe the experimental setup, including data sources, preprocessing steps, and environmental constraints. Compare defenses not only on overall robustness but also on cost, complexity, and maintainability. Visualizations such as trade-off curves and failure mode diagrams help stakeholders grasp where improvements matter most. Finally, include actionable recommendations that practitioners can implement within reasonable budgets and timelines. Transparent, evidence-based communication fosters collaboration between researchers, operators, and decision-makers seeking robust AI systems.
ADVERTISEMENT
ADVERTISEMENT
Embrace a holistic, continual improvement mindset for resilience.
Realistic deployment scenarios demand continuous monitoring and lifecycle management. Once a model is deployed, regression tests should run automatically whenever data or code changes occur. Monitoring should detect drift, sudden performance drops, or new attack patterns, triggering alerts and, if necessary, automated mitigations. It is crucial to link monitoring insights to remediation workflows so teams can respond promptly. This ongoing vigilance helps prevent silent degradation and ensures protection remains aligned with evolving threats. Robustness is not a one-time achievement but a durable capability that adapts as models age and environments shift. Establish a cadence for reassessment that mirrors the risk profile of the application.
Finally, cultivate a culture that prioritizes ethics, accountability, and collaboration. Adversarial robustness is as much about governance as it is about technique. Involve diverse stakeholders—from domain experts to security engineers and end users—in the evaluation process. This multiplicity of perspectives helps surface blind spots and fosters responsible deployment. Organizations should codify decision rights, define escalation paths, and ensure that safety concerns are given weight alongside performance objectives. By building a community around robust practices, teams can sustain conscientious development even as technologies evolve rapidly.
The most enduring robustness programs are proactive rather than reactive. They anticipate emerging threats by maintaining a living risk register, updating defense strategies, and validating them against fresh data. Periodic red-teaming exercises and third-party audits provide external validation and new ideas. Simultaneously, teams should invest in education and tooling that demystify adversarial concepts for nonexperts, enabling broader adoption of best practices. A culture of curiosity, paired with disciplined experimentation, drives meaningful gains over time. By integrating lessons learned from failures and near misses, organizations strengthen their resilience against unexpected challenges and complex threat landscapes.
In sum, principled adversarial robustness evaluation requires clarity, realism, and collaboration. By aligning threat models with deployment contexts, emphasizing end-to-end system behavior, and maintaining transparent reporting, practitioners can produce trustworthy assessments. The field benefits when researchers share methodologies, data, and results in accessible formats, enabling replication and extension. Ultimately, robust AI emerges not from single techniques but from disciplined processes that continuously adapt to evolving risks while preserving user trust and safety. This evergreen approach helps organizations navigate uncertainty and build resilient, responsible AI systems for the long horizon.
Related Articles
This evergreen guide explores quantization strategies that balance accuracy with practical deployment constraints, offering a structured approach to preserve model fidelity while reducing memory footprint and improving inference speed across diverse hardware platforms and deployment scenarios.
July 19, 2025
Ensemble methods have evolved beyond simple voting, embracing calibration as a core practice and stacking as a principled approach to blend diverse models. This evergreen guide explains practical strategies, theoretical underpinnings, and implementation tips to boost the reliability of probabilistic outputs in real-world tasks across domains.
July 29, 2025
A practical, evergreen guide detailing proactive readiness, transparent communication, and systematic response workflows to protect users when model failures or harms occur in real-world settings.
August 06, 2025
This evergreen guide outlines practical, scalable strategies for training on massive data, leveraging streaming sharding, progressive sampling, and adaptive resource management to maintain performance, accuracy, and cost efficiency over time.
August 11, 2025
A structured approach to experimental design that leverages machine learning driven propensity weighting, balancing bias reduction with variance control, and providing practical steps for credible causal inference in observational and semi-experimental settings.
July 15, 2025
This evergreen guide outlines practical, model-agnostic steps to construct and evaluate counterfactual scenarios, emphasizing methodological rigor, transparent assumptions, and robust validation to illuminate how outcomes could change under alternate conditions.
August 09, 2025
A practical exploration of loss landscape shaping and regularization, detailing robust strategies for training deep networks that resist instability, converge smoothly, and generalize well across diverse tasks.
July 30, 2025
Thoughtful governance boards align ethics, technical integrity, and operational impact in AI projects, creating accountability, reducing risk, and guiding sustainable innovation across data systems and decision pipelines.
August 09, 2025
In modern ML workflows, safeguarding data in transit and at rest is essential; this article outlines proven strategies, concrete controls, and governance practices that collectively strengthen confidentiality without sacrificing performance or scalability.
July 18, 2025
This evergreen guide explores practical strategies for building clustering explanations that reveal meaningful group traits, contrast boundaries, and support informed decisions across diverse datasets without sacrificing interpretability or rigor.
July 19, 2025
Designing reinforcement learning reward functions requires balancing long-term goals with safety constraints, employing principled shaping, hierarchical structures, careful evaluation, and continual alignment methods to avoid unintended optimization paths and brittle behavior.
July 31, 2025
Hierarchical modeling enables deeper insight by structuring data across levels, aligning assumptions with real-world nested processes, and systematically propagating uncertainty through complex, multi-layered structures in predictive tasks.
July 19, 2025
This evergreen exploration outlines practical strategies for designing privacy-aware gradient aggregation across distributed sites, balancing data confidentiality, communication efficiency, and model performance in collaborative learning setups.
July 23, 2025
A practical exploration of multi step evaluation frameworks that balance objective performance measures with user experience signals, enabling systems to be assessed comprehensively across realism, reliability, and satisfaction.
August 07, 2025
A practical guide to designing hierarchical feature stores that balance data freshness, scope, and complex aggregations across teams, ensuring scalable, consistent, and reliable model features in production pipelines.
August 08, 2025
Collaborative model development thrives when diverse teams share reproducible artifacts, enforce disciplined workflows, and align incentives; this article outlines practical strategies to harmonize roles, tools, and governance for durable, scalable outcomes.
July 18, 2025
Effective calibration practices align predictive probabilities with observed outcomes, ensuring reliable decision support across diverse data conditions, model families, and real-world deployment challenges while preserving interpretability and operational efficiency.
August 12, 2025
This evergreen guide explores methods for embedding domain expertise into machine learning pipelines, highlighting strategies that improve model relevance, align outcomes with real-world needs, and build user trust through transparent, evidence-driven processes.
July 26, 2025
This evergreen guide presents a principled approach to building surrogate models that illuminate opaque machine learning systems, balancing fidelity, simplicity, and practical usefulness for stakeholders seeking trustworthy predictions and transparent reasoning.
July 15, 2025
This guide outlines rigorous privacy risk assessment practices for organizations sharing model outputs and aggregated analytics externally, balancing transparency with confidentiality while safeguarding personal data and defining actionable governance checkpoints.
July 17, 2025